Only substantive prayer in this Notice of Motion is prayer clause (a) which reads thus: "(a) That this Hon'ble Court be pleased to allow the Applicant to claim a refund of Rs.79,00,055/- (Seventy Nine Lakh and Fifty Five Rupees) being the proportional deduction for thte short delivery to the Applicant of the subject cargo of 17,000 MT discharged
nma317.doc from the Vessel MV. Vishwa Ekta and lying at the Tuticorin Port sold by the order of this Hon'ble Court dated 15th February 2017."
By Judgment and Order dated 6th September 2016, the Appeal No. 115 of 2017 (Appeal (L) No.794 of 2015) in which this Notice of Motion was taken out has been dismissed by a detailed Judgment.
The order impugned in the appeal is dated 5th October 2015 on Judges Order No.215 of 2014 which is the Order the passed by the learned Single Judge to extend the precept order under section 46 of the Code of Civil Procedure,1908 in the execution application. The execution application is still pending. Therefore, the relief which is prayed for in this Notice of Motion cannot be granted in a disposed of appeal. The Notice of Motion is accordingly disposed of. However, it will be open for the applicant to adopt appropriate remedy for seeking relief which is sought in this Notice of Motion.
